Abstract Organic‐ligand‐containing frameworks have drawn considerable attention due to their multifunctional properties as well tunable structures for broad applications. Among numerous synthesis methods developed in the past two decades, electrochemical processing has been demonstrated one of most efficient, safe, and facile ways realize large‐scale highly controllable production organic‐ligand‐containing frameworks. In this review, progress electrochemically induced crystallization thin film fabrication is summarized a well‐rounded way. Besides, mechanism parameters are also discussed. Titanium(IV)-based metal-organic frameworks (Ti-MOFs) have received significant attention in recent years because of their numerous photocatalytic applications; however, the synthesis new Ti-MOFs with precise crystal structures is still challenging. Herein, three single-crystal (denoted as FIR-125–FIR-127) are rationally synthesized by employing a large Ti44-oxo cluster precursor to assembly organic ligand. Big single-crystals can be successfully obtained and structurally determined X-ray diffraction. During synthesis, transferred small Ti8O8(CO2)16 building units Ti-MOF. In addition, FIR-125 exhibit high stability, permanent porosity, activity. This work provides strategy toward big growth through slow transformation titanium-oxo clusters.
